How MDMA Enters and Affects Your Body


When you take MDMA, usually by swallowing a pill or capsule, it quickly enters your bloodstream through the digestive system. From there, it crosses the blood-brain barrier and begins to influence your brain chemistry.


MDMA primarily targets three key neurotransmitters:


  • Serotonin: Responsible for mood, empathy, and happiness.

  • Dopamine: Linked to pleasure and reward.

  • Norepinephrine: Controls alertness and energy.


By increasing the release and blocking the reuptake of these chemicals, MDMA floods your brain with neurotransmitters, especially serotonin. This surge leads to the characteristic feelings of euphoria, emotional warmth, and heightened sensory perception.


Physical Changes During an MDMA Experience


The physiological effects of MDMA are wide-ranging and can vary depending on the dose, individual health, and environment. Some common physical changes include:


  • Increased heart rate and blood pressure: MDMA stimulates the sympathetic nervous system, causing your heart to beat faster and your blood vessels to constrict.

  • Elevated body temperature: The drug can disrupt your body's ability to regulate heat, sometimes leading to dangerous overheating.

  • Muscle tension and jaw clenching: Many users report tight muscles, especially in the jaw, which can cause discomfort.

  • Dilated pupils: This is a typical sign of stimulant use.

  • Reduced appetite and dry mouth: MDMA suppresses hunger and decreases saliva production.


These physical effects usually begin within 30 to 60 minutes after ingestion and can last for several hours.


Psychological Effects and Emotional Impact


MDMA is well-known for its powerful psychological effects. Users often describe:


  • Enhanced empathy and connection: Many feel a strong sense of closeness to others, which is why MDMA is sometimes called the "love drug."

  • Elevated mood and euphoria: The flood of serotonin creates intense feelings of happiness and well-being.

  • Altered sensory perception: Colors may seem brighter, sounds more vivid, and touch more pleasurable.

  • Reduced fear and anxiety: MDMA can lower inhibitions and ease social anxiety, making communication feel easier.


These effects make MDMA popular in social settings but also contribute to its potential for misuse.


How MDMA Affects the Brain’s Chemistry


The brain’s serotonin system plays a central role in the MDMA experience. Normally, serotonin is released into the synapse (the space between neurons) and then reabsorbed by the releasing neuron. MDMA disrupts this process by:


  • Forcing neurons to release large amounts of serotonin.

  • Blocking serotonin reuptake, keeping it active longer.

  • Affecting dopamine and norepinephrine in similar ways but to a lesser extent.


This massive serotonin release explains the mood boost and emotional openness users feel. However, it also means serotonin levels drop sharply after the drug wears off, which can lead to feelings of depression or fatigue in the days following use.


Risks and Potential Side Effects


While many people use MDMA without serious issues, it carries risks that should not be ignored:


  • Dehydration and overheating: Because MDMA raises body temperature and causes sweating, users can become dangerously dehydrated, especially in hot environments like clubs.

  • Serotonin syndrome: Taking MDMA with other drugs that increase serotonin can cause a life-threatening condition with symptoms like rapid heartbeat, high fever, and seizures.

  • Neurotoxicity: Some studies suggest that heavy or frequent MDMA use may damage serotonin neurons, potentially affecting mood and memory long-term.

  • Psychological distress: After the drug wears off, some users experience anxiety, depression, or confusion.


Understanding these risks is crucial for anyone considering MDMA use.

How Long Do MDMA Effects Last?


The effects of MDMA typically begin 30 to 60 minutes after ingestion. The peak experience lasts about 3 to 4 hours, followed by a gradual decline over the next few hours. Residual effects, such as fatigue or mood changes, can last for several days.


The intensity and duration depend on factors like:


  • Dosage taken

  • Purity of the substance

  • Individual metabolism

  • Environment and mindset during use


Practical Tips for Safety


If someone chooses to use MDMA, certain steps can help reduce risks:


  • Stay hydrated: Drink water regularly but avoid excessive amounts to prevent water intoxication.

  • Take breaks from dancing or physical activity: This helps prevent overheating.

  • Avoid mixing with other substances: Especially other stimulants or antidepressants.

  • Use in a safe environment: Being with trusted friends reduces the chance of accidents.

  • Start with a low dose: This helps gauge individual sensitivity.


These precautions do not eliminate risks but can make the experience safer.


The Aftereffects and Recovery


After the MDMA experience, many users notice a "comedown" period. This can include:


  • Fatigue and low energy

  • Mood swings or mild depression

  • Difficulty concentrating

  • Sleep disturbances


These symptoms result from depleted serotonin levels and usually improve within a few days. Rest, hydration, and balanced nutrition support recovery.
